Christian Action for Relief and Development-CARD

Christian Action for Relief and Development-CARD is a Christian humanitarian development agency of the Episcopal Church of South Sudan; founded in 2011 by the Senior Clergies of the Episcopal Church of South Sudan Diocese of Wau, The Most Rev, Archbishop Moses Deng Bol and Rev. Andrew Apiny Macham.

The organisation is legally registered by the South Sudan Relief and Rehabilitation Commission (RRC) as non-political, non-religious, non-profit making, non-proselyte, non –partisan.

Organisation Vision: To Transform Social Inequality and empowered Community for a Just World in Which People Lives with Dignity and Prosperity.

Mission: To Equip Community with leadership Development Skills and Economic Empowerment, Through Innovative Development Programs, Human Rights Advocacy and Community engagement.

CARD motto is “Restoring Hopes, Inspiring Actions, Transforming Lives” This motto is underpinned the vision and mission its driven from the Book of (James 2:18) which talk about God-talk without God-acts is outrageous nonsense. Faith and works, works and faith, fit together hand in glove.
